Security Advisory: Venus Exploit due to Compromised Core Pool Controller Redirected to a Malicious Contract Address

By: theblockbeats.news|2025/09/02 09:52:15

BlockBeats News, September 2nd, Cryptocurrency security platform Cyvers Alerts detected a suspicious transaction of $27 million on the Venus Protocol on the BNB network. According to the report, the Venus core pool controller was compromised to a malicious contract address, which then withdrew assets worth $27 million, including vUSDC, vETH, and other tokens.
